Gur Bhanga in context

With 166 people at the 2011 Census, Gur Bhanga was the 6133rd most populous of its district's 8695 villages, below the district average of 597.

Literacy stood at 60.14%, 16.7 points below the district's rural average of 76.87%.

Among children aged 0–6 the ratio was 867, 56 below the rural national 923.

60.8% of the population were recorded as workers, 17.3 points above the district's rural rate.
